A Transportation Management System is a software system designed to streamline shipping process workflows and manage transportation operations, including shipping price comparison between carriers and services, carrier selection, shipment optimization, document management, and freight management. TMS software provides users with the tools to streamline shipping process workflow, increase visibility, and enhance decision-making capabilities.

The future of transportation management systems lies in continual advancements in software and technology. Modern transportation management systems are incorporating artificial intelligence (AI), machine learning, predictive analytics, and blockchain technology to offer more sophisticated solutions for supply chain planning and optimization. AI and machine learning enable TMS to learn from historical data, predict potential disruptions, and recommend optimal routing and carrier selection. Predictive analytics provide shippers with actionable insights to anticipate demand fluctuations, manage inventory levels, and optimize delivery schedules.
Additionally, blockchain technology will likely enhance the security, transparency, and efficiency of TMS by providing immutable records of transactions, improving payment processes, and ensuring accurate tracking of goods throughout the supply chain. Companies that are both parcel shippers and Less than truckload (LTL) shippers can optimize their parcel cost and LTL cost by utilizing multi-carrier shipping software integrated with TMS technology. This solution allows shippers to compare shipping rates and services across multiple carriers, such as FedEx, USPS, UPS, SAIA, FedEx Freight, Southeastern Freight Lines, AAA Cooper, and others less-than-truckload carriers. By comparing LTL and parcel shipping options, companies can ensure they are securing the lowest possible costs for each shipment. This is especially beneficial when deciding whether a heavy parcel shipment might be more cost-effective to ship via LTL or vice versa. This comprehensive comparison and selection process streamlines the shipping process workflows, resulting in significant cost savings and enhanced efficiency.
